Solid Food Waste — Emissions (CO2eq) in Italy
Italy: Solid Food Waste — Emissions (CO2eq) was 1,950 kt in 2023. ▲ Rising
Solid Food Waste — Emissions (CO2eq) in Italy,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Italy recorded 1,950 kt for solid food waste — emissions (co2eq) in 2023. That is the highest value across all 34 years on record.
The figure is up 0.1% on the previous year and up 1.1% over ten years.
Over the whole period, solid food waste — emissions (co2eq) in Italy peaked at 1,950 kt in 2023 and was at its lowest, 1,461 kt, in 1990.
That places Italy 60th out of 192 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ently rising across the 34 years of available data.
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1990s | 1,651 kt | 1,461 kt | 1,784 kt | 10 |
| 2000s | 1,859 kt | 1,801 kt | 1,907 kt | 10 |
| 2010s | 1,932 kt | 1,914 kt | 1,943 kt | 10 |
| 2020s | 1,947 kt | 1,944 kt | 1,950 kt | 4 |

About this data
The FAOSTAT domain on Emissions from Pre- and post- agricultural production includes the greenhouse gas (GHG) emissions, and related activity data, generated from pre- and post-agriculture production stages of the agri-food syst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). The domain includes methane (CH4), nitrous oxide (N2O), carbon dioxide (CO2) and CO2 equivalent (CO2eq) emissions from the above activities as well as the aggregate fluorinated gases (F-gases) emissions. Estimates are available by country, with global coverage and are updated annually.The FAOSTAT domain disseminates information estimates of CH4, N2O, CO2 emissions, F-gases, their aggregates in CO2eq in units of kilotonnes (kt, or 10^6 kg), and the underlying activity data. CO2eq emissions are computed by using the IPCC Fifth Assessment report global warming potentials, AR5 (IPCC, 2014). Data are available for most countries and territories, for standard FAOSTAT regional aggregations, and for Annex I and non-Annex I country groups.
